Protect Your Cash App: PIN Setup and Essential Safety Measures
Keeping your Cash App account safe is crucial. One of the most important steps you can take is to set up a strong PIN. This numeric code acts as an extra layer of protection against unauthorized access. When you first install the Cash App, you'll be prompted to create a PIN. Choose a combination that's easy for you to remember but difficult for others to guess.
Once your PIN is set, consider these extra safety measures:
* Periodically review your transaction history for any unusual activity.
* Be cautious about sharing your Cash App details with anyone you don't trust.
* Avoid using public Wi-Fi networks to access your Cash App, as they can be insecure.
* Keep your phone and device software current to patch any security vulnerabilities.
* Enable two-factor authentication (copyright) for an additional layer of protection.
By following these recommendations, you can help safeguard your Cash App account and lower the risk of identity compromise.
